D-Link Holds Training Seminars for Partners

By ChannelTimes Staff
Mumbai, Sep 18, 2008 1640 hrs IST

D-Link India, the networking company, has rolled out its "IP NETVISION 2010" - a series of 80 events comprising trainings and seminars - in over 40 cities across the country.

This one-day conference focuses on technologies like wireless, video surveillance and networking solutions for the future.

Anand Mehta, AVP-marketing, D-Link India, said, "We at D-Link believe in staying ahead of time. Our philosophy has always been to extend unconditional support and cooperation to our business partners and customers. We have always guided our business associates on their road to success, by sharing our knowledge and know-how of the industry trends."

Kandarp Jhala, AVP-national channel, D-Link India, added, "The idea of having roadshows is to take D-Link to its customers and give them an experience of the D-Link brand in a very refreshing manner. Through these roadshows, we are providing a platform to our channel partners to sell their products. We are also conducting workshops to fulfil the training needs of our partners."

The company is reaching out to its business partners and end-users through roadshows to update them with technological trends and developments.
